6)ventrolateral preoptic nucleus of hypothalamus and suprachiasmatic nucleus of the hypothalamus
Exposure to daylight stimulates nerve pathway.the light-dark signals are sent via the optic nerve to the suprachiasmatic nucleus which uses them to reset the circadian cycle everyday
